in reply to Tasha99

Awwwww don’t panic. I set off the music first and then started the run off. It’s quite easy 👌🏼

If you download the Garmin connect app there’s a ‘training’ section in the 3 little dots in the bar at the bottom. All you need to do is say what your goal is, how often you train and it’ll set up a plan for you and when you sync your phone with the watch it transfers the training plan to the watch. (There’s YouTube videos for how to do it all if I’ve confused you) For your first run it wants you to do a 2 minute warm up 5 min run and 2 min warm down - to assess your fitness I think, but I just selected ‘continue’ and carried on doing my 30 minutes 🤣 It’s very clever!
